Traffic patterns to be changed at Punchbowl for Memorial Day weekend


Advertiser Staff

Traffic controls will be put in place tomorrow at the National Memorial Cemetery of the Pacific in anticipation of heavy Memorial Day weekend visitations.

From tomorrow until Monday, a police officer will be stationed at each of the following three intersections:
— Tantalus and Puowaina drives.
— Puowaina Drive and Hookui Street.
— Hookui and Auwaiolimu streets.
Left turns from Hookui to Auwaiolimu will be prohibited.
Traffic flow within the cemetery will be one-way during the weekend. Cemetery personnel will direct traffic .
